Язык стиля цитирования: изменение библиографии

Я использую Zotero и хочу немного изменить библиографию:

<group delimiter="">
  <text value=""/>
  <text variable="URL"/>
  <group prefix=". " suffix="">
    <text term="accessed" suffix=" "/>      
    <date variable="accessed">
       <date-part name="day" suffix=" "/> 
       <date-part name="month" form="" suffix=" "/>
       <date-part name="year" form=""/>
    </date>
  </group>
</group>

Я подозреваю, что здесь используется название используемого термина в библиографии (см. Ниже):

accessed 1 March 2017

Это я хочу изменить на верхний регистр:

Accessed 1 March 2017

Если я изменю текстовый термин на "Доступен", я получаю сообщение об ошибке

Какие-либо предложения?


person Melanie Patricia Gerber    schedule 01.07.2017    source источник


Ответы (1)


Вы можете изменить <text term="accessed" suffix=" "/> на <text term="accessed" text-case="capitalize-first" suffix=" "/>. См. http://docs.citationstyles.org/en/stable/specification.html#text-case.

В качестве альтернативы вы можете использовать <text value="Accessed" suffix=" "/>, но обычно использование терминов является предпочтительным, потому что термины позволяют стилям более легко локализоваться на разные языки.

person Rintze Zelle    schedule 02.07.2017
comment
Кроме того, это не совсем связано с вашим вопросом, но в вашем коде есть проблема с form="", что недопустимо в CSL. Я рекомендую использовать спецификацию CSL в качестве справочника при редактировании кода (см. документы. citationstyles.org/en/stable/specification.html#date-part, в частности) и с помощью валидатора CSL (validator.citationstyles.org). - person Rintze Zelle; 02.07.2017